Since pets are completely dumb, very weak, almost uncontrollable, using their skills purely on random without any logic whatsoever, and I’m not even going into the ton of actual bugs involving them, most of us simply ignore them and let them roam freely around the battlefield, as the only other option left is setting them on "avoid battle", making them even more worthless and that much annoying, constantly tripping a step behind your back (you can’t even "lock them in" and let them stay unsummoned, as they automatically pop out the moment you take a first hit).
As for being lucky to have a pet, you’re forgetting that because of them, "pet-classes" (let’s say Rangers and partially Necros) got heavily weakened, as by theory, they should be getting half of their damage output from their pet (that especially in the case of Rangers).

A-net has never done well with pets. Ever. But, removing them just because they’re bad in WvW isn’t exactly a solution. They’re still good for solo PvE, serve a pretty good purpose in PvP, as they give knockdown, cripple, two seconds of quickness, and fear or immobilize every 20 seconds...
So no, they don’t need to go away.

My pet doesn’t die that often, maybe it’s the build. I run a Greatsword/Longbow ranger, with Rampage as One for an elite. I use a wolf, and an alpine wolf. I’ve got the Wilderness Survival trait that gives him and myself protection when I dodge roll. He is healed every time I am healed... I swap, often, and that’s really the key.
